pkgsrc-WIP-changes arch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
sfwbar: update to 1.0_beta17
Module Name: pkgsrc-wip
Committed By: kikadf <kikadf.01%gmail.com@localhost>
Pushed By: kikadf
Date: Wed Mar 18 15:44:29 2026 +0100
Changeset: aa392e97b8a98461ae95b55f163bac627604b1ad
Modified Files:
sfwbar/Makefile
sfwbar/PLIST
sfwbar/distinfo
Added Files:
sfwbar/patches/patch-config_memory.source
Log Message:
sfwbar: update to 1.0_beta17
To see a diff of this commit:
https://wip.pkgsrc.org/cgi-bin/gitweb.cgi?p=pkgsrc-wip.git;a=commitdiff;h=aa392e97b8a98461ae95b55f163bac627604b1ad
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
diffstat:
sfwbar/Makefile | 8 ++++++--
sfwbar/PLIST | 10 ++++++----
sfwbar/distinfo | 7 ++++---
sfwbar/patches/patch-config_memory.source | 26 ++++++++++++++++++++++++++
4 files changed, 42 insertions(+), 9 deletions(-)
diffs:
diff --git a/sfwbar/Makefile b/sfwbar/Makefile
index 33f9b30ba8..7f6df80372 100644
--- a/sfwbar/Makefile
+++ b/sfwbar/Makefile
@@ -1,9 +1,9 @@
# $NetBSD$
-DISTNAME= sfwbar-1.0_beta16.1
+DISTNAME= sfwbar-1.0_beta17
CATEGORIES= x11
MASTER_SITES= ${MASTER_SITE_GITHUB:=LBCrion/}
-GITHUB_TAG= d30db7c77fde25093f55eae8203f5a4995768152
+GITHUB_TAG= v${PKGVERSION_NOREV}
MAINTAINER= kikadf.01%gmail.com@localhost
HOMEPAGE= https://github.com/LBCrion/sfwbar/
@@ -14,6 +14,7 @@ USE_LANGUAGES= c c++
USE_TOOLS+= pkg-config
LDFLAGS+= ${COMPILER_RPATH_FLAG}${PREFIX}/lib/sfwbar
+MESON_ARGS+= -Dbsdctl=disabled
MESON_ARGS+= -Dpulse=disabled
MESON_ARGS+= -Dpipewire=disabled
MESON_ARGS+= -Dalsa=disabled
@@ -22,6 +23,9 @@ MESON_ARGS+= -Dnm=disabled
MESON_ARGS+= -Dxkb=enabled
MESON_ARGS+= -Ddbus=enabled
+post-install:
+ ${RM} ${DESTDIR}${PREFIX}/share/sfwbar/memory.source.orig
+
.include "../../wip/gtk-layer-shell/buildlink3.mk"
.include "../../devel/meson/build.mk"
diff --git a/sfwbar/PLIST b/sfwbar/PLIST
index 49a9db74aa..0a671dc4cd 100644
--- a/sfwbar/PLIST
+++ b/sfwbar/PLIST
@@ -12,6 +12,7 @@ lib/sfwbar/network.so
lib/sfwbar/xkbmap.so
man/man1/sfwbar-appmenu.1
man/man1/sfwbar-bluez.1
+man/man1/sfwbar-dbus.1
man/man1/sfwbar-idle.1
man/man1/sfwbar-idleinhibit.1
man/man1/sfwbar-mpd.1
@@ -27,7 +28,6 @@ share/locale/zh_TW/LC_MESSAGES/sfwbar.mo
share/sfwbar/alsa.widget
share/sfwbar/backlight.source
share/sfwbar/backlight.widget
-share/sfwbar/battery-svg.widget
share/sfwbar/battery.source
share/sfwbar/battery.widget
share/sfwbar/bluez-popup.widget
@@ -52,6 +52,8 @@ share/sfwbar/desktop-directories/Utility.directory
share/sfwbar/fan-rpm.widget
share/sfwbar/icons/misc/comp.svg
share/sfwbar/icons/misc/cpu.svg
+share/sfwbar/icons/misc/dialog-cancel-symbolic.svg
+share/sfwbar/icons/misc/dialog-ok-symbolic.svg
share/sfwbar/icons/misc/fan.svg
share/sfwbar/icons/misc/fforward.svg
share/sfwbar/icons/misc/hibernate-symbolic.svg
@@ -149,7 +151,7 @@ share/sfwbar/icons/weather/snowshowers_polartwilight.svg
share/sfwbar/icons/weather/snowshowersandthunder_day.svg
share/sfwbar/icons/weather/snowshowersandthunder_night.svg
share/sfwbar/icons/weather/snowshowersandthunder_polartwilight.svg
-share/sfwbar/idle.widget
+share/sfwbar/idleinhibit.widget
share/sfwbar/lan-bps.widget
share/sfwbar/language.widget
share/sfwbar/mb-temp.widget
@@ -162,7 +164,7 @@ share/sfwbar/mpd-module.widget
share/sfwbar/mpd.source
share/sfwbar/mpd.widget
share/sfwbar/ncenter.widget
-share/sfwbar/network-module.widget
+share/sfwbar/network.widget
share/sfwbar/oneline.config
share/sfwbar/privacy.widget
share/sfwbar/rfkill-bt.widget
@@ -174,7 +176,6 @@ share/sfwbar/showdesktop.widget
share/sfwbar/startmenu.source
share/sfwbar/startmenu.widget
share/sfwbar/swap.source
-share/sfwbar/sway-lang.widget
share/sfwbar/switcher.config
share/sfwbar/t2.config
share/sfwbar/twoline.config
@@ -197,5 +198,6 @@ share/sfwbar/wbar-sway-lang.widget
share/sfwbar/wbar-temp.widget
share/sfwbar/wbar.config
share/sfwbar/weather.widget
+share/sfwbar/wifi-secret.widget
share/sfwbar/wifi.widget
share/sfwbar/winops.widget
diff --git a/sfwbar/distinfo b/sfwbar/distinfo
index 6789614aae..8c71e15943 100644
--- a/sfwbar/distinfo
+++ b/sfwbar/distinfo
@@ -1,6 +1,7 @@
$NetBSD$
-BLAKE2s (sfwbar-1.0_beta16.1-d30db7c77fde25093f55eae8203f5a4995768152.tar.gz) = a02801bb12d28d3917fbf0a3e70571741dbb81ff380ea9ae162326d2991a5ce7
-SHA512 (sfwbar-1.0_beta16.1-d30db7c77fde25093f55eae8203f5a4995768152.tar.gz) = a55c9c3b982ec1d452fa666cf664d760b45e45c990bcbe62d3e6eeebf0ba0e9fe2fd4707c3c5d311942103ff296bf1cdff239c9811dcdfaf8a6f9b7a45ccefbc
-Size (sfwbar-1.0_beta16.1-d30db7c77fde25093f55eae8203f5a4995768152.tar.gz) = 515619 bytes
+BLAKE2s (sfwbar-1.0_beta17.tar.gz) = b088dacefd56c0cdbd52d094a30540e411085c53060ea877d0e893867c21c0bd
+SHA512 (sfwbar-1.0_beta17.tar.gz) = f9444ace3e01997aecba7bf2a6e1edfdbe6bf67022d7ec60874e2f86da20e0e3c1a41defa7720f74eb1ff646ce65fa0343a89186883c3ac7ae59001e22aeaf23
+Size (sfwbar-1.0_beta17.tar.gz) = 518367 bytes
+SHA1 (patch-config_memory.source) = 5509fed7731c4257438e7fd0af520e1a943083d8
SHA1 (patch-modules_network.c) = b91f130ff7b53a162315f6ab0372a8a383c49510
diff --git a/sfwbar/patches/patch-config_memory.source b/sfwbar/patches/patch-config_memory.source
new file mode 100644
index 0000000000..4f1fe49e04
--- /dev/null
+++ b/sfwbar/patches/patch-config_memory.source
@@ -0,0 +1,26 @@
+$NetBSD$
+
+* NetBSD support
+
+--- config/memory.source.orig 2026-03-18 10:39:49.620486824 +0000
++++ config/memory.source
+@@ -6,13 +6,17 @@ file("/proc/meminfo") {
+ MemTotal = RegEx("^MemTotal:[\t ]*([0-9]+)[\t ]")
+ MemFree = RegEx("^MemFree:[\t ]*([0-9]+)[\t ]")
+ MemCache = RegEx( "^Cached:[\t ]*([0-9]+)[\t ]")
+- MemBuff = Regex("^Buffers:[\t ]*([0-9]+)[\t ]")
++ MemBuff = RegEx("^Buffers:[\t ]*([0-9]+)[\t ]")
++ MemShared = RegEx("^MemShared:[\t ]*([0-9]+)[\t ]")
+ }
+
++Set IsNetBSD = MemShared.count
+ Set XPageSize = BSDCtl("vm.stats.vm.v_page_size")
+ Set XMemTotal = If(!Ident(BSDCtl),MemTotal,Val(BSDCtl("vm.stats.vm.v_page_count"))*XPageSize)
+ Set XMemFree = If(!Ident(BSDCtl),MemFree,Val(BSDCtl("vm.stats.vm.v_free_count"))*XPageSize)
+ Set XMemCache = If(!Ident(BSDCtl),MemCache,Val(BSDCtl("vm.stats.vm.v_inactive_count"))*XPageSize)
+ Set XMemBuff = If(!Ident(BSDCtl),MemBuff,Val(BSDCtl("vm.stats.vm_laundry_count"))*XPageSize)
+-Set XMemUtilization = (XMemTotal-XMemFree-XMemCache-XMemBuff)/XMemTotal
++Set XMemUtil_NetBSD = (XMemTotal-XMemFree-XMemCache)/XMemTotal
++Set XMemUtil = (XMemTotal-XMemFree-XMemCache-XMemBuff)/XMemTotal
++Set XMemUtilization = If(IsNetBSD,XMemUtil_NetBSD,XMemUtil)
+ Set XMemPresent = If(Ident(BSDCtl),$XPageSize!="",MemTotal.count)
Home |
Main Index |
Thread Index |
Old Index